Facilities ticket — Halewick Tower, night shift.

Issue: support team reporting east stairwell reader rejecting badges after midnight. Reader was reset this morning; firmware updated. Overnight crew should now badge as normal. If the reader fails again, use the manual keypad by the fire door — do not prop the door. Log any further failures with the time and badge name. Temporary keypad code for the fallback door is below.

door code, tajeg-fawip: bdg-K-62

Ticket: SUPP-4410. While publishing the postmortem bundle for the Quillford stale-cache incident, the attachment failed its signature check in the portal. The bundle was regenerated after signing, invalidating the original signature. We have re-signed the corrected bundle. Support team: when customers verify the download, direct them to use the current publishing key, provided below.

rollout seal: bky4_x7Gc

- [ ] Step 7: Archive cold storage buckets (Glacierline tier). Confirm both ceremony witnesses are present, verify bucket manifests match the Oxbow ledger, then seal the archive key shares. Plugin authors may observe but not handle shares. Once sealed, the archive index itself is encrypted and can only be reopened with the passphrase below.

vault phrase of badup-hahig = tamael-aldael-kelmir-istael-fenok-istwyn-tamius-jorath-oliion